|Posted .This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.First, I must say that this is the first new PC I’ve had in about 7 years. Going straight from Windows 7 to Windows 10. I avoided all the upgrade to 10 tricks Microsoft tried to force through. And never took that jump. I was quite happy with Windows 7. With that being said, this PC of course, came with Windows 10 pre-installed. While, not overly excited to jump to 10, I figured it was time. This review isn’t supposed to be about Windows 10 but since it’s part of the PC, I’m not going to have much choice making comments about some of my likes and dislikes. This is a major upgrade to me and this PC is smoking fast!! I had always been a gamer and this is the first “box” PC I’ve had since I got a Packard Bell 486 about 25 years ago. Each PC I’ve had since then was hand built. I was one of “those guys” that had to have the latest and greatest. I spent more money on upgrades of RAM, video cards and CPUs than I care to remember. Now my games, aside from one, all reside on my PS4 and XBOX One. So this PC wasn’t picked up with games in mind. First, it has integrated graphics. That used to make me cringe just thinking about it. Not the case with this one. The one game I still play on PC, World War II Online, is actually quite playable. I was getting 50-60 fps with graphics on medium. I was surprisingly pleased with that. I’ll probably still pick up a video card for this at some point but the integrated graphics of this are very acceptable. I’m more into photo editing now than gaming so the next test was with Photoshop and Lightroom and it’s quite capable of multitasking between the 2 with plenty of other windows open. It zips right along with no bogging down with the 16 gigs of ram – upgradable to 64 but I see no need for any near future upgrades to the ram. Initial set up went fairly smooth. The only real issue I had was probably my own fault but still worth mentioning. My email pasword was automatically saved in my old PC and I had typed it wrong (forgetting what it was) into the new Windows Mail app and it never told me the password was incorrect. It just never downloaded any mail. Took about 30 minutes of playing around and a password reset to actually figure out that was what the problem was. Not a PC issue, it was an app issue but you’d think they’d give you a “password incorrect” message. After building my own PCs for years, going into Device Manager and looking for that yellow ! was a normal activity and was quite pleased to see no yellow ! in this one. Not that there should have been anything there but I still checked that. Hard to untrain myself. Never been a fan of built in software and usually uninstall that stuff from any PC that came with it. This came with a very minimum of stuff to get rid of. McAfee for some reason got stuck at 76% updating on the first night so I left it on overnight and it was still at 76% when I woke up. Didn’t want it anyway so I just uninstalled it. Not sure what that was all about but it’s gone now. Spent the last couple weeks getting used to Windows 10 before writing this review and I honestly have nothing negative to say about Windows 10 at all. It’s different for sure. But everything I do so far is doable on this aside from a USB microscope I have doesn’t seem to have WIN10 drivers and I just can’t get it to work yet. Both my printers installed seemlessly. The wireless internet detected my router just fine and I was online instantly. It boots up unbelievably fast even after loading all my stuff. In literally 30 seconds after pressing the power button, I’m logged in and online. The PC looks cool and modern. The 4 USB slots in the front are awesome to have. The only, and I mean only thing I don’t really like and it’s kind of nitpicky I know, is the CD drive is a laptop CD drive rather than a normal PC drive with a real tray. This just pops out a little bit and you have to lock the disc into the center and push it closed. Maybe that’s the cool thing nowadays but I don’t like it and will probably swap it out with a different one at some point. Maybe I’ll pop a Bluray drive in down the road. Overall, I give this PC 5 stars. No real issues on setup or use that I didn’t create myself. Very pleased Thanks!!
